Oak Grove approves purchase of police portable radios and batteries

Oak Grove Board of Aldermen · February 3, 2026

Summary

The Board of Aldermen approved a capital purchase for three portable police radios and 21 batteries, with staff saying the acquisition will cost less than the $18,000 allocated in the capital improvement fund.

The Oak Grove Board of Aldermen approved a capital expenditure to purchase three portable police radios and additional batteries at its Feb. 2 meeting.

The police chief said the department began a phased replacement of older radios when a full replacement in 2025 proved infeasible and that this year’s capital-improvement request covers three radios plus 21 batteries. "So this is a capital improvement request that we had in this year's budget to purchase 3 portable radios for the officers," the chief said, and added the purchase would come in for less than the $18,000 that was budgeted.

An alderman moved to approve the purchase; the motion was seconded and passed by voice vote. The chief told the board that batteries are the weakest point in current equipment because they lose life quickly with 24/7 use. The board did not record a roll-call vote for this item in the transcript.

Next steps discussed included proceeding with procurement under the capital-improvement fund; the transcript did not record a final vendor selection or exact purchase price.
